California Department of Forestry and Fire Protection (CAL FIRE) is inviting you to review and respond to this Request for Quote for Information Technology Services (RFQ-ITS), entitled RFQ-ITS 26-0044 HR Grievance Tracking System Refresh Project. The purpose of this solicitation is to obtain professional services on a time-and-materials basis for the design, development, testing, and deployment of a software solution that manages public employee grievances and complaints across multiple levels of review. The Contractor will work collaboratively with the CAL FIRE Labor Relations Office to build a configurable, secure, and data-driven system that supports intake, tracking, reporting, and analysis. Read the attached document carefully. The RFQ-ITS due date is October 2nd, 2026 by 2:00 PM PT.

D--HYDROLOGICAL DATABASE (HDB) SUPPORT SERVICES
Solicitation # 140R4026R0021
The Bureau of Reclamation is seeking qualified contractors for an Indefinite-Delivery Indefinite-Quantity (IDIQ) contract to provide technical support, maintenance, and development services for the Hydrological Database (HDB) system. This effort, identified by solicitation number 140R4026R0021 and NAICS 541511, is designed to support critical water management operations across multiple regions, including the Upper and Lower Colorado Basin, Missouri Basin, and California-Great Basin. The estimated period of performance spans five years, from December 15, 2026, to December 15, 2031. The contractor will be responsible for on-demand technical support, database maintenance, the development of data access and visualization tools, and ensuring full compliance with federal cybersecurity standards, including NIST, FISMA, SSDF, and SDLC. Services will be performed primarily remotely, with potential travel to various Reclamation area offices. The contract will utilize firm-fixed-price task orders, with performance evaluated against strict Minimum Acceptable Quality Levels (MAQL). Key performance metrics include a two-hour response time for urgent calls, a 90 percent on-time delivery rate for task order deliverables, and 100 percent adherence to cybersecurity mandates. Required expertise includes advanced Oracle database operations and proficiency in programming languages such as Java, Python, C#, and Perl. The procurement is managed by the Upper Colorado Regional Office in Salt Lake City, Utah, with Kyle Goddard serving as the primary point of contact.

Modernized VAERS Reporting Application
Solicitation # 75D301-26-Q-00146
The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ention is seeking a contractor to design, develop, and deliver a modernized, responsive web application for the Vaccine Adverse Event Reporting System (VAERS). The project focuses on improving the reporting experience for both the public and healthcare providers through a redesigned landing page, a guided reporting workflow with branching logic, and a low-code interface for CDC personnel to make updates. Key performance targets include page load times of 3 seconds or less, a median end-to-end submission time of 10 minutes or less, and a 30 percent reduction in submission abandonment. The application will operate within the CDC-managed MS Azure cloud environment and must comply with federal standards including HIPAA, FISMA, FedRAMP, and Section 508 accessibility guidelines. This firm-fixed-price contract has a period of performance from September 28, 2026, to June 27, 2027, with an estimated not-to-exceed value of 31,500 dollars. Award will be based on a best value tradeoff process where technical approach, management approach, and similar experience are significantly more important than price. Contractors must adhere to strict security and privacy protocols, including the handling of Controlled Unclassified Information and the submission of an Artificial Intelligence Use Compliance and Risk Management Plan if AI is utilized. Performance is primarily remote within the United States, requiring routine coordination with CDC personnel in Atlanta, Georgia.
